Druck auf Anfrage Neuware - Printed after ordering - This book constitutes the thoroughly refereed post-conference proceedings of the International Conference on Computer Vision and Graphics, ICCVG 2008, held in Warsaw, Poland, in November 2008. The 48 revised full papers presented were carefully reviewed and selected from numerous submissions. The papers are organized in topical sections on image processing, image quality assessment, geometrical models of objects and scenes, motion analysis, visual navigation and active vision, image and video coding, virtual reality and multimedia applications, biomedical applications, practical applications of pattern recognition, computer animation, visualization and graphical data presentation.

Taschenbuch. Condition: Neu. Neuware -For the last decades, as the computer technology has been developing, the importance of human-computer systems interaction problems was growing. This is not only because the computer systems performance characteristics have been im-proved but also due to the growing number of computer users and of their expectations about general computer systems capabilities as universal tools for human work and life facilitation. The early technological problems of man-computer information exchange ¿ which led to a progress in computer programming languages and input/output devices construction ¿ have been step by step dominated by the more general ones of human interaction with-and-through computer systems, shortly denoted as H-CSI problems. The interest of scientists and of any sort specialists to the H-CSI problems is very high as it follows from an increasing number of scientific conferences and publications devoted to these topics. The present book contains selected papers concerning various aspects of H-CSI. They have been grouped into five Parts: I. General H-CSI problems (7 papers), II. Disabled persons helping and medical H-CSI applications (9 papers), III. Psychological and linguistic H-CSI aspects (9 papers), IV. Robots and training systems (8 papers), V. Various H-CSI applications (11 papers).Springer Verlag GmbH, Tiergartenstr. 17, 69121 Heidelberg 584 pp. Englisch.

This item is printed on demand - it takes 3-4 days longer - Neuware -Computer-aided data processing methods are widely used in various areas of experimental sciences, technology, medicine, agriculture, etc. This book is destined to present a specific sort of experimental data processing methods based on morphological spectra (MS). The concept of morphological spectra is based on a modification of the system of orthogonal Walsh functions, their adaptation to analysis of numerical discrete data structures: time series, single or serial images, etc. The main merits of morphological spectra in practical applications consist in easiness of their calculations (as being based on combinations of two main operations: data addition and/or subtraction) as well as simple spectral components' geometrical interpretation. The book presents theoretical backgrounds of the MS-based methods and their application to numerical data series analysis, image analysis (in particular - analysis of textures), image enhancement by filtering, numerical evaluation of image filtering procedures and selected tasks of analysis of serial images. The described methods are illustrated by examples taken mainly from the area of biomedical engineering. 152 pp. Englisch.
